TL;DR Summary

Eerie photos reveal a rise in deer with flesh bubbles caused by deer cutaneous fibroma virus, spread by insects like mosquitoes and ticks, with outbreaks expected to increase during warm summer months across the U.S., raising concerns about wildlife health and potential human risks.
